Thoratec Switzerland GmbH, a part of the medical device division of Abbott Laboratories, is a Fortune 500 company with over 115,000 employees worldwide. As the global market leader in implantable and extracorporeal blood pumps utilizing magnetic levitation technology, we develop and manufacture life-saving systems in Zurich for patients suffering from advanced heart failure who require short- or long-term circulatory support.

Located in the heart of Zurich, our team of around 130 employees focuses on the development, quality, and production of the CentriMag system and the HeartMate 3.

Position Overview

We are se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Production Logistician to join our dynamic team. The Production Logistician operates with limited supervision and applies specialized knowledge to support key production logistics activities. This position necessitates a thorough understanding of operational needs to ensure the efficient flow of materials and goods throughout the production process.

Key Responsibilities

  • Receiving & Inspection:
    • Receive incoming goods and inspect them according to specified requirements.
    • Identify and report discrepancies to relevant stakeholders (supervisor, manufacturing engineers, purchasing).
  • Internal Logistics:
    • Transfer materials from the warehouse to production areas.
    • Manage storage and retrieval of goods.
    • Conduct cycle counts and inventory checks.
  • Shipping:
    • Process and dispatch shipping orders.
    • Handle shipments involving dangerous goods in compliance with regulations.
    • Support production order processing.
  • Shopfloor Management:
    • Maintain a clean and organized workspace through 5S practices.
    • Actively participate in shop floor meetings and contribute to continuous improvement initiatives.

Qualifications

  • Completed school diploma or equivalent education.
  • Minimum of 2 years’ experience in logistics, production, or a related field.
  • Proficiency in SAP and Microsoft Excel.
  • Strong communication skills in both German and English.
  • Willingness and ability to work in shifts, if required.
